Philippine president meets Singapore counterpart on two-day state visit

SINGAPORE (Reuters) — Philippine President Rodrigo Duterte met with his Singapore counterpart Tony Tan on Thursday (December 15) in the city state. During the state visit, Duterte, who has been criticised abroad for his ‘war on drugs’, reaffirmed the importance of ASEAN countries not interfering in each others’ internal affairs. “We are committed to make the ASEAN region and beyond safe and secure from traditional and emerging transnational threats,” Duterte said. Philippines set to roll out tough no-smoking law

By Kanupriya Kapoor and Enrico Dela Cruz MANILA (Reuters) – Philippine President Rodrigo Duterte is set to sign a regulation this month banning smoking in public across Southeast Asia’s second-most populous country, rolling out among the toughest anti-tobacco laws in the region. Philippines worried, says more Chinese boats spotted at disputed shoal

  (REUTERS) The Philippines expressed “grave concern” on Sunday and demanded an explanation from China’s ambassador over what it said was an increasing number of Chinese boats near the disputed Scarborough Shoal in the South China Sea. China welcomes positive statements by Philippine President on South China Sea: Chinese official

CCTV — China welcomes the positive statements on the South China Sea issue made by Philippine President Rodrigo Duterte and hopes that China and the Philippines can go back to negotiation table to settle the disputes, Chinese Vice Foreign Minister Liu Zhenmin said in Beijing at a press conference Wednesday.
